Accounts Payable Analyst managing high-volume invoices for real estate and construction projects. Role based in Guadalajara, supporting U.S. clients with accurate payment processing.
Responsibilities
Manage the complete AP cycle from invoice receipt to payment, including coding, matching contracts/change orders/purchase orders, and obtaining approvals.
Review and process high-volume invoices for multiple capital projects, ensuring accuracy and compliance with budget and contract terms.
Manage electronic workflows, ensuring invoices are coded correctly and processed within required timelines (48-hour SLA for first review).
Obtain and track required vendor documentation such as lien waivers and supporting materials.
Research and resolve invoice discrepancies by collaborating with project owners and vendors.
Interpret contract provisions to help resolve claims, void invoices, adjust payments, and reissue transactions as needed.
Prepare reclassifications and datasheets to ensure accurate project and budget allocation.
Monitor project compliance, verify final approvals, and ensure all contract conditions are met prior to final invoice processing.
Manage quarterly PO close-outs for capital projects.
Support vendor setup and help drive adoption of electronic invoicing systems.
Build and maintain strong vendor relationships and serve as a point of contact for inquiries on payment and budget status.
Assist with audit support, including compiling documentation and reports.
Perform additional projects and tasks as required.
